Jeep Gladiator Achieves First Place In Midsize Pickup Segment Of J.D. Power 2025 Initial Quality Study
The Jeep Gladiator has achieved a leading position in the J.D. Power 2025 U.S. Initial Quality Study (IQS), securing first place in the Midsize Pickup segment. It excelled in seven out of ten key categories, such as driving experience and infotainment. This marks the second time in three years that the Gladiator has topped its segment.
In addition to the Gladiator's success, the Jeep Wrangler also performed admirably, securing second place in the Compact SUV category. The overall performance of these models contributed to a 13-point improvement for the Jeep brand, highlighting progress in addressing customer feedback.
Dodge made significant strides in the 2025 IQS, climbing 24 positions to rank seventh among automotive brands. This represents one of the largest improvements across all brands surveyed. Meanwhile, Chrysler reduced its problems per 100 vehicles by 13 points, showcasing enhanced owner satisfaction.
The Chrysler Pacifica also demonstrated strong performance by finishing second in the Minivan segment. This result underscores Chrysler's commitment to maintaining high levels of owner-reported satisfaction.
Yuri Rodrigues, Stellantis North America's senior vice president of quality, stated, "We’re building momentum and, more importantly, building trust." He emphasized that these results reflect their dedication to listening to customers and prioritizing them in decision-making processes.
J.D. Power conducted surveys with new-vehicle buyers about their initial 90 days of ownership. The study measured problems experienced per 100 vehicles to evaluate brand performance effectively.
